This one appeared on e-bay, and it has to be the wildest color insulator I've ever seen, two tone cobalt and violet Neman (HEMAH) C3H (SZN)

I've seen these in cobalt and cornflower, but never in this psych-o-delic "tie dye" color combination.

Neman is still a currently producing glass plant, so there is always the possibility that they could be manufacturing new and "exotic" insulators to meet the collector's desires. No major thing to do like Hemingray did, and run off a few insulators with leftover glass from colorful bottle or "art glass" runs.
